ACCEPTING NEW CLIENTS FOR TELETHERAPY. I serve individuals, couples, families, children (age 6+) and adolescents. I specialize in child and adolescent trauma services (TF-CBT) and have extensive experience working with the GLBTQ community. Areas of focus include but are not limited to: anxiety/panic, depression, self- esteem, behavioral issues, sexual/physical trauma, marital/family issues, aging challenges, grief, chronic pain, anger management, OCD, life transitions, relationship challenges, improving coping skills and effective communication.My objective is to help all individuals realize their full potential.
I provide Cognitive Behavioral Therapy & Person-Centered Therapy using a culturally sensitive, holistic framework. Together we will focus on identifying and changing problematic thought processes that negatively impact how we feel and behave. We will also examine how past experiences inform our current thoughts, views, feelings, and behaviors.
I believe in building a strong therapeutic alliance with my clients and providing a safe, non-judgmental space to work through sensitive issues.
